At a recent event hosted by The Hindu Tech, Dr. G. Viswanathan, Chancellor of VIT, underscored the pivotal role higher education plays in bridging the gap of inequality and propelling economic growth in India. He stressed that access to quality education is a fundamental right that can transform lives and uplift communities. By equipping individuals with advanced skills and knowledge, higher education institutions can empower a new generation of leaders and innovators.
Dr. Viswanathan pointed out that the disparity in educational opportunities is a significant barrier to economic progress. He highlighted the need for policy reforms and increased investment in the education sector to ensure that students from all backgrounds can benefit from higher education. By fostering an inclusive educational environment, the nation can harness the full potential of its diverse population, leading to a more equitable society.
Moreover, the VIT Chancellor emphasized that a robust higher education system is crucial for driving innovation and competitiveness on a global scale. He called for collaboration between academia, industry, and government to create a dynamic ecosystem that nurtures talent and encourages research and development. By focusing on these strategic areas, India can not only reduce inequality but also solidify its position as a leading economic power in the coming decades.
